diff --git a/frontend/src/app/jobs/loading.tsx b/frontend/src/app/jobs/loading.tsx
index 6616fa2..8f02b7a 100644
--- a/frontend/src/app/jobs/loading.tsx
+++ b/frontend/src/app/jobs/loading.tsx
@@ -1,4 +1,10 @@
+import ThreeDotLoader from "@/components/ui/loading_dots";
+
// frontend/src/app/jobs/loading.tsx
export default function JobLoading() {
- return
Loading Job...
;
+ return (
+
+
+
+ );
}
diff --git a/frontend/src/app/loading.tsx b/frontend/src/app/loading.tsx
index fc80ef0..a90d50d 100644
--- a/frontend/src/app/loading.tsx
+++ b/frontend/src/app/loading.tsx
@@ -1,3 +1,9 @@
+import ThreeDotLoader from "@/components/ui/loading_dots";
+
export default function Loading() {
- return Loading...
;
+ return (
+
+
+
+ );
}
diff --git a/frontend/src/components/ui/loading_dots.tsx b/frontend/src/components/ui/loading_dots.tsx
new file mode 100644
index 0000000..7c47b05
--- /dev/null
+++ b/frontend/src/components/ui/loading_dots.tsx
@@ -0,0 +1,41 @@
+export default function ThreeDotLoader({
+ className,
+ mode = "dark",
+}: {
+ className?: string;
+ mode?: "light" | "dark";
+}) {
+ return (
+
+ );
+}